Различия
Показаны различия между двумя версиями страницы.
| Предыдущая версия справа и слева Предыдущая версия Следующая версия | Предыдущая версия | ||
| vm:pgsql:доступ_к_базе_conf [2025/08/05 09:44] – admin | vm:pgsql:доступ_к_базе_conf [2025/08/05 09:47] (текущий) – admin | ||
|---|---|---|---|
| Строка 1: | Строка 1: | ||
| - | ====== Доступ к базе | + | ====== Доступ к pgSQL из вне или в лок сети ====== |
| Строка 7: | Строка 7: | ||
| Если postgresql установлен не в докере откройте файл с правами администратора.\\ | Если postgresql установлен не в докере откройте файл с правами администратора.\\ | ||
| - | Обычно он находится по пути: / | + | Обычно он находится по пути: |
| < | < | ||
| - | |||
| - | |||
| - | |||
| В этом файле каждая строка задает правило доступа в формате: | В этом файле каждая строка задает правило доступа в формате: | ||
| - | text | + | < |
| - | # TYPE DATABASE | + | host |
| - | host | + | |
| - | host — означает подключение по TCP/IP. | + | |
| - | + | ||
| - | all в столбцах DATABASE и USER означает, | + | |
| - | + | ||
| - | 192.168.1.0/ | + | |
| - | md5 — метод аутентификации с паролем. | + | host — означает подключение по TCP/IP.\\ |
| + | all в столбцах DATABASE и USER означает, | ||
| + | 192.168.1.0/ | ||
| + | md5 — метод аутентификации с паролем.\\ | ||
| Для разрешения подключения с любого IP (небезопасно, | Для разрешения подключения с любого IP (небезопасно, | ||
| - | text | + | < |
| - | host all | + | |
| После внесения изменений сохраните файл. | После внесения изменений сохраните файл. | ||
| Перезапустите PostgreSQL, чтобы применить изменения: | Перезапустите PostgreSQL, чтобы применить изменения: | ||
| - | bash | + | < |
| - | sudo systemctl restart postgresql | + | |